In Python, indentation plays a crucial role in code readability and structure, especially with multiline strings. Multiline strings, defined using triple quotes (“”” or ”’), allow for strings that span multiple lines, preserving the formatting within the quotes. Proper indentation of these strings is important for maintaining code readability and avoiding errors. This article explores various techniques and best practices for handling multiline string indentation in Python. Handling Indentation with TextwrapThe textwrap module in Python provides utilities to help manage multiline strings, including dedent, which removes any common leading whitespace from each line in the input text.

ConclusionProper indentation of multiline strings in Python is essential for maintaining code readability and preventing unexpected formatting issues. Techniques such as using the textwrap module, strip(), and aligning strings with parentheses help manage multiline strings effectively. Adopting these best practices ensures your code remains clean and readable, especially when dealing with multiline text data. |
